Talk of a leadership change at Lucasfilm is intensifying, with reports suggesting that Kathleen Kennedy may soon step down as president, with a succession plan in place. According to Puck News, Dave Filoni is expected to take the lead on the creative direction of the Star Wars franchise, while Lynwen Brennan will manage the business side. Industry insider Matthew Belloni indicates an announcement could come within weeks. As speculation continues, it remains uncertain if this marks the end of Kennedy’s tenure or a transition phase for Lucasfilm.
